Prediction of the heat transfer coefficient for the plate-tubed heat exchangers / 板鰭管式熱交換器之熱傳遞係數的預測

碩士 / 國立成功大學 / 機械工程學系 / 85 / The heat transfer coefficient of the plate finned-tube heat exchanger is searched mainly in this thesis. Since the field of fluid that flows across fins is very complex. The previous scholars is to simplify the complexity of the problem so as to be the constant for the heat transfer coefficient of the fluid. In fact, the heat transfer coefficient should be the function of location. We will tell the difference from the heat transfer coefficient as to be the function of location to it as to be the constant and say some heat transfer phenomenon in the fins in this thesis.
 In addition, the fin efficiency and the fin heat transfer coefficient are predicted by the scheme of inverse heat conduction in the thesis. The main purpose of that is that we want to estimate the heat transfer coefficient with the information of fin temperature measured by thermocouple. because the prediction of the heat transfer coefficient if exactly or not is influence on the fin efficiency deeply, so the results for the method of inverse is used to comparison by the fin efficiency.
 Finally, it should be mentioned that most of previous scholars tried to determine the heat transfer coefficient of the flow fluid straightforwards and subsequently the fin efficiency. The inverse method of this thesis need only to measure the fin temperature and can predict fin efficiency. Thus, the present method is very powerful.
